MUARA, Friday, 14 June 2019 – Royal Brunei Navy (RBN) commemorates its 54th Anniversary today by holding a
Doa Kesyukuran Ceremony held at the Surau Al-Huda, RBN.  Present as the Guest of Honour was First Admiral Haji Othman bin Haji Suhaili @ Suhaily, Commander of RBN.

The ensuing event was a Parade Ceremony held at the RBN Parade Square with a total of 455 RBN personnel involved in the parade led by Lieutenant Commander Ade Roddiane bin Hj Mohd Rosdi, RBN

Commander of RBN, in his speech pledged on RBN’s undivided loyalty to His Majesty Sultan Haji Hassanal Bolkiah Mu’izzaddin Waddaulah Ibni Al-Marhum Sultan Haji Omar ‘Ali Saifuddien Sa’adul Khairi Waddien, Sultan and Yang Di-Pertuan of Negara Brunei Darussalam. He highlighted three significant topic areas that need to be enhanced and implemented by the RBN continuously. These include on the need of fleet operational preparedness, the importance on RBN’s capacity building and quality development and active cooperation with related agencies especially pertaining to security of the country. Towards the end of his speech, he urged for RBN to keep on working together in delivering tasks and responsibilities given that aligned with RBN’s vision to deliver a robust, responsive and resource-efficient navy.
